To find the center of dilation, we'll draw two lines: one from A to A ′ and one from B to B ′ . The point where the two lines intersect is the center of dilation. In a dilation, if the scale factor is greater than 1, the shape will stretch away from the center of dilation, getting larger. If the scale factor is between 0 and 1, the shape will shrink towards the center, getting smaller. All the lengths in the figure change by the same scale factor. Created by Sal Khan.

Rotations preserve distance, so the center of rotation must be equidistant from point P and its image P ′ . That means the center of rotation must be on the perpendicular bisector of P P ′ ― . The center of dilation is a point of reference from which the distance to the object to be dilated is observed, and then it is scaled by the factor of dilation. This point can lie on the object, inside the object, or outside the object. All dilations are similar to the original figure. Dilations have a center and a scale factor. The center is the point of reference for the dilation and the scale factor tells us how much the figure stretches or shrinks. A scale factor is labeled \(k\).
